India lost to host China 3-0 in quarterfinal of AFC U17 Women’s Asian Cup China 2026 at the Suzhou Sports Centre Stadium on Monday.

The result dashed the Young Tigresses’ hopes of securing a historic qualification for the FIFA U17 Women’s World Cup Morocco 2026, though the campaign still marked India’s best-ever performance in the competition with a first appearance in the knockout stage.

For China, Huang Qinyi (38’), Liu Yuxi (45+4’) through penalty and Li Qixian (90’) scored the goals.

India U17 Women’s Team Starting XI:

Munni, Elizabed Lakra, Divyani Linda, Thandamoni Baskey, Julan Nongmaithem, Ritu Badaik, Pritika Barman, Redima Devi Chingkhamayum, Abhista Basnett, Alva Devi Senjam, Joya
